122. - Cataulacus traegaordhi Sants. Congo belge: Kai Bumba [[worker]] et Ganda Sundi [[queen]], (Dr. Sghouteden) - Stanleyville a Kilo (L. Burgeon) [[queen]]. Les [[worker]] different a peine du type par les mandibules moins striees (comme chez la var. ugandensis) et les stries de la base du gastre legerement plus accusees.
Published as part of Santschi, F., 1924, Descriptions de nouveaux formicides africains et notes diverses. - II., pp. 195-224 in Revue de Zoologie Africaine 12 on page 220
